Final answer:
The correct pronoun to use in the sentence 'let Mohan and (me/I) stay here' is 'me'. This is because 'me' is used as the object of a verb or preposition.
Step-by-step explanation:
In English, we choose pronouns carefully depending on the role they play in a sentence. In the case of your sentence, 'let Mohan and (me/I) stay here,' the correct pronoun to use would be 'me.' Here's why: When a pronoun is used as the object of a verb or preposition, 'me' is the appropriate choice. Therefore, the correct sentence is: 'Let Mohan and me stay here.'
